深入浅出GAMP算法
时间: 2023-08-31 16:13:40 浏览: 269
GAMP算法是一种近似消息传递算法,用于处理变量维度较大时的计算复杂度问题。它的核心思想是通过近似计算来简化消息传递过程。具体来说,GAMP算法将涉及到消息传递的计算替换为使用简化的计算。这些简化计算使用了替代的参数,如p^i_p(t)和τ_i^p(t),来代替原始的消息传递参数p^i→j(t)和τ_i→j(t)。这种替代计算能够大大简化计算过程。
在GAMP算法的流程中,首先进行初始化计算,计算τ_i^p(t)、p^i(t)、s^i和τ_i^s(t)。然后,根据这些参数计算Δ_i→j(t, x_j),这在最后的计算中体现为对r^j的计算。接下来,计算τ_j^r和r^j,用于最后对x^j的计算。
总的来说,GAMP算法通过近似计算来简化消息传递过程,从而降低了计算复杂度。它的算法流程可以被简化为初始化计算和消息传递计算。通过这种方式,GAMP算法能够有效地处理变量维度较大的情况。\[1\]\[2\]\[3\]
#### 引用[.reference_title]
- *1* *2* *3* [深入浅出GAMP算法(中): GAMP](https://blog.csdn.net/weixin_39274659/article/details/120488409)[target="_blank" data-report-click={"spm":"1018.2226.3001.9630","extra":{"utm_source":"vip_chatgpt_common_search_pc_result","utm_medium":"distribute.pc_search_result.none-task-cask-2~all~insert_cask~default-1-null.142^v91^control_2,239^v3^insert_chatgpt"}} ] [.reference_item]
[ .reference_list ]
阅读全文